Resident urges deeper review of 'Flock' vehicle surveillance after cameras installed
Summary
A resident told aldermen the city's Flock camera system raises privacy and data-sharing concerns and asked the board to pause and investigate the system's data handling and vendor ties.
Buddy Huggins told the Board of Aldermen he has concerns about Ozark's use of the Flock camera system, saying the network of cameras can create persistent vehicle tracking and that data uploaded to the cloud may be shared widely. "When it goes on the cloud, it's there forever," Huggins said, adding he believes heat maps and vehicle tracking are being produced.
